Tip: If you want to correct perspective distortions, you can always find a size reference point in the photo. In this case, I think the small, round purple object with "12+" in it was originally a completely round object. In this case it is deformed. Things like this can help adjust photos to the correct relative dimensions. When photographing an object that can't be photographed parallel to the lens, it's always helpful to place something next to it as a reference (like a coin). Just a tip.
